Multiple Victims Injured When Tractor-Trailer Slams Slowing Cars On Route 80 In Roxbury: Police
A multi-vehicle crash caused by a tractor-trailer on Route 80 earlier this week left multiple people injured on Monday evening, March 17, authorities said.
New Jersey State Police responded to the eastbound lanes near milepost 32.2 at 6:10 p.m. in Roxbury, after a Subaru SUV, Honda SUV, Mazda passenger car, and Volvo tractor-trailer collided, according to Sgt. Jeffrey Lebron.
Investigators determined that the Subaru, Honda, and Mazda had slowed for traffic when the Volvo rear-ended all three vehicles before veering off the road and striking the guardrail, police said.

Two Injured In Four-Vehicle Crash On Route 30 In Manheim Township
A four-vehicle crash involving a tractor-trailer, a pickup truck, an SUV, and a sedan left two people injured and caused major traffic delays in Manheim Township, Lancaster County, on Thursday, March 6, emergency dispatchers said.
The collision happened around 6:30 a.m. on Route 30 Eastbound at the Lititz Pike/Route 501 exit. The tractor-trailer veered off the eastbound lanes and partially blocked Chester Road, while the pickup truck was severely damaged, officials said.
The crash caused significant backups on Route 30, Route 283, Chester Road, and surrounding roads.
